Ekweremadu, best for igbos


Emergence of Senator Ike Ekweremadu as the Deputy Senate President has been described as the best
thing that has happened to the South East people.
  Speaking in Abuja, former House of Representatives member, representing Onitsha North and South constituency, Hon. Gozie Agbakoba said that Igbos would not be missed in the scheme of things in the country.
  Hon. Agbakoba also described Senator Ekweremadu as an experienced person in the business of law-making adding that his experience as Deputy Senate President for some years would help the current Senate President stabilize very well in his duty.
  He advised Senators and House of Representatives members at the National Assembly from the south east zone to always make laws that will benefit their people.
  Agbakoba, who was one time Chairman, Nigerian Union of Journalists (NUJ) old Anambra State appealed to law-makers at all levels of government to always work harmoniously with the executive arm of government towards upliftment of the lots of people, particularly, the down-trodden in the society.
  “There is every need for law-makers to think of people they represent; there is every need for them to think of their constituency and need to carry their constituents along with what they do in the lower and upper chambers of the parliament”, he noted.
  He called on Senators and House of Representatives members to put aside the leadership tussle and come together as one united, indivisible body to work for good of the people of the nation.
  “Yes, elections are over and I urge the 8th Assembly parliamentarians to work like a family; make laws that everyone will benefit irrespective of party leaning, ethnicism, religion and age”, he declared.
